| Oral/Parenteral Toxicity: |
oral-rat LD50 800 mg/kg Rubber Chemistry and Technology. Vol. 45, Pg. 627, 1972.
oral-mouse LD50 1584 mg/kg BEHAVIORAL: ATAXIA
BEHAVIORAL: SOMNOLENCE (GENERAL DEPRESSED ACTIVITY)
LUNGS, THORAX, OR RESPIRATION: DYSPNEA Toksikologicheskii Vestnik. Vol. (6), Pg. 29, 1997.
intravenous-mouse LD50 178 mg/kg BEHAVIORAL: ALTERED SLEEP TIME (INCLUDING CHANGE IN RIGHTING REFLEX)
BEHAVIORAL: CONVULSIONS OR EFFECT ON SEIZURE THRESHOLD
BEHAVIORAL: COMA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ry. Vol. 7, Pg. 203, 1959.
intraperitoneal-mouse LD50 200 mg/kg National Technical Information Service. Vol. AD277-689
